Transaction 7517f8e3ef70002c4b55c70d73737bf15cf31f2ca40e8b38c5ebc453e58daa9c
1 Input
2 Outputs
- 7517f8e3ef70002c4b55c70d73737bf15cf31f2ca40e8b38c5ebc453e58daa9c:0
- 7517f8e3ef70002c4b55c70d73737bf15cf31f2ca40e8b38c5ebc453e58daa9c:1
value 33315509
address 35SL4yPBwuTCr8LWBUZrwYxZfdZxFHs8X3
value 10000000
address 3PjW1rNDAtsfdWmjAuGsGnNnbiaWfo4DYF